Over 600+ vacancies offered at job fair organized by District Employment & Counselling Centre Samba
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egram

SAMBA, MARCH 14: A job fair was organized today by the District Employment & Counselling Centre Samba with the objective of providing employment opportunities to jobseekers of the district.

A total of 24 companies participated in the job fair and collectively offered more than 600 vacancies across various sectors. The participating companies included Cadila Pharmaceutical Ltd, Saraswati Agro Chemicals (INDIA) Pvt. Ltd, Jai Beverages Pvt Ltd, VKC Nuts Pvt Ltd, Abinza Pharma Pvt. Ltd, Astrofine Pharma Pvt ltd, Zeiss Pharma Ltd and other recruiters. The companies offered job opportunities in sectors such as Industry, Pharmaceutical, Agriculture, Security, Sales and other related fields.

The Job Fair witnessed enthusiastic participation from the youth. A total of 150 candidates were shortlisted and 20 candidates were selected on the spot by different recruiting employers.

Speaking on the occasion, Member Legislative Assembly Ramgarh Constituency Devender Kumar Manyal guided and encouraged the youth to actively participate in the Job Fair and avail advantage of the employment opportunities being offered by the participating companies.

Assistant Director Employment Naresh Kumar advised the youth to get themselves registered on the Mission YUVA (www.missionyuva.jk.gov.in) portal to avail the incentives and schemes of the Government meant for unemployed youth. He informed that after registration with the Mission YUVA, candidates become eligible to apply for subsidized financial assistance schemes including Nano and MSME in Sunrise & Focus sectors, besides

Existing Enterprises scheme for promoting the existing business. He further informed that the registered candidates can apply for jobs online through Mission YUVA portal and can also avail short-duration free skill development courses being organized by the Employment Department during job fairs.
